Gov. Hochul is Investing $1M to Speed up Rent Relief

(Jimmy Jordan / WRFI) ITHACA, NY — New York is putting $1 million dollars into marketing and outreach efforts for the State’s Emergency Rental Assistance Program (ERAP).  The $2.7 billion dollar Rental Assistance Program was dubbed ‘poorly managed’ by the State Comptroller’s Office two weeks ago, namely for it’s poor outreach, sluggish application approvals, and…
